Congratulations to Eric Jin on winning the second Edmonton International Qualifier. He scored 4/5 to finish half a point ahead of Tri Tran and Paris Dorn.
Thanks to Sam Hoekman for running the event.
Congratulations to Hemant Srinivasan on winning the Steinitz-Menchik Classic with a 5.5/6 score. This is his third consecutive year posting an outstanding result at the Steinitz-Menchik, totalling a 15-2-1 record over the 18 games. Second place went to Anand Rishi Chandra at 5/6, who was the only player to draw the winner this year.
Congratulations also to Jack Sheng, who won the second section with a 5.5/6 score, half a point ahead of Mats Philipzig. Results for both sections can be viewed here. Thanks to the CCC for organizing, and Sean Wu for directing.

Congratulations to Team Alberta on a 3rd place finish at the Canadian Chess Challenge in Moncton! Alberta defeated Quebec 6.5-5.5 in the final round to take third by half a point at 7 match points out of 9, behind Ontario (9) and British Columbia (7.5).
Extra congrats to the top individual finishers:
Grade 3: Felix Zhang, 3rd place
Grade 4: Lucas Wang, 3rd place
Grade 10: Eric Jin, 3rd place
Grade 12: Mark Ivanescu, 2nd place
Big thanks to Cristian Ivanescu and Yao Wang for organizing the team.



Congratulations to FM Blagoj Gicev, who won the first Qualifier with a 4/5 score, half a point ahead of a six-way tie! Gicev, Mahan Eshraghi, and Ron Offengenden (top of the second place tie) earn free entry into the Edmonton International at the end of the Summer.
